#1e01a8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e01a8 is composed of 11.8% red, 0.4%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.1% cyan, 99.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 250.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 33.1%. #1e01a8 color hex could be obtained by blending #3c02ff with #000051.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#1e01a8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e01a8 has RGB values of R:30, G:1,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 1966504.

Shades and Tints of #1e01a8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02000c is the darkest color, while #f9f8ff is the lightest one.
